Core Viewpoint - Google's announcement of its AI design tool, Stitch, which supports Vibe Design, has led to a significant drop in Figma's stock price, highlighting the competitive threat posed by major tech companies in the software industry [1][4][12]. Group 1: Stock Market Impact - Figma's stock price fell by approximately 13% within two days following the announcement of Google's new tool, with an 8% drop on the first day and a further 5% on the second day [1]. - Year-to-date, Figma's stock has declined by about 35%, aligning with the overall downturn in the software industry [4]. - Adobe's stock also experienced a decline of around 3% during the same period, indicating a broader trend affecting multiple companies in the sector [4]. Group 2: Google's New Tool Features - Vibe Design allows users to create UI designs using voice commands, eliminating the need for traditional design processes [8]. - Stitch introduces five major capabilities: 1. An AI-native canvas that supports simultaneous handling of images, code, and product requirement documents [8]. 2. Enhanced agent capabilities that understand context and can operate across screens [9]. 3. Real-time voice interaction for immediate feedback and suggestions [9]. 4. Instant prototyping that transforms static screens into interactive prototypes [10]. 5. Consistency in design through a unified design system and the use of DESIGN.md for exporting and importing design rules [10]. Group 3: Competitive Landscape - Figma is positioned as a significant player in the UI/UX design tool market, with a projected revenue of $1.06 billion in 2025, reflecting a 41% year-over-year growth [12]. - The entry of Google into the market with Stitch poses a direct threat to Figma, as both tools offer overlapping functionalities [14]. - Google has advantages over Figma, including the potential for free access to Stitch, extensive distribution through its existing user base, and the ability to bundle services within its enterprise offerings [14][15][16]. Core Viewpoint - The traditional design process is considered obsolete due to the rise of AI, but the role of designers is evolving rather than being replaced. Designers are now focusing on implementation and execution rather than just creating high-fidelity mockups [2][11][12]. Design Work Changes - The design process has undergone significant changes, with a shift from extensive mockup creation to a more agile approach where rapid iterations and real-time user feedback are prioritized [10][11][12]. - Designers now spend only 30% to 40% of their time on mockups, compared to 60% to 70% in the past, as the pace of product development accelerates [4][31]. New Roles for Designers - Three types of designers are emerging as most competitive in the AI-driven landscape: 1. Generalists who excel in multiple core skills, achieving near top-tier proficiency [7][90]. 2. Deep specialists with advanced technical skills or exceptional visual design capabilities [7][91]. 3. Craft new grads who are early in their careers but demonstrate exceptional learning agility and creativity [7][93]. AI Tools in Design - Designers are increasingly utilizing AI tools like Claude for various tasks, including coding and project management, which enhances collaboration with engineers [5][32]. - The integration of AI tools allows designers to focus on higher-level strategic tasks while automating routine aspects of design work [5][33]. Rapid Iteration vs. Deep Research - The industry is moving towards rapid execution and iteration, where products are released with known flaws but improved through user feedback, rather than relying solely on extensive research and mockups [22][46]. - This approach is particularly effective in the context of AI, where user interactions often reveal insights that were not anticipated during the design phase [22][46]. Experience of Designers at AI Companies - Working as a designer in AI companies involves keeping up with fast-paced developments and collaborating closely with engineers to refine products [24][25]. - Designers are expected to engage in coding and implementation, blurring the lines between design and engineering roles [18][28]. Future of Design Management - The role of design managers is evolving, requiring them to be more involved in hands-on work to understand the changing landscape and effectively guide their teams [66][69]. - Managers must balance providing direction while also being deeply engaged in the execution of design tasks [69][70]. Figma(FIG) - 2025 Q4 - Earnings Call Transcript
2026-02-18 23:00
Financial Data and Key Metrics Changes - Figma reported Q4 2025 revenue of $304 million, representing a 40% year-over-year growth rate, and full-year revenue of $1.056 billion, up 41% year-over-year [4][22] - The net dollar retention rate for customers with more than $10,000 in ARR increased by five percentage points quarter-over-quarter to 136%, marking the highest rate in the last 10 quarters [4][23] - The company ended the year with $1.7 billion in cash, cash equivalents, and marketable securities [4][28] Business Line Data and Key Metrics Changes - Figma expanded from four to eight products in 2025 and launched over 200 features, including new AI-native functionality [4] - Weekly active users of Figma Make grew over 70% quarter-over-quarter, with over 50% of paid customers spending more than $100,000 in ARR using Figma Make weekly [11][22] Market Data and Key Metrics Changes - International revenue grew 45% year-over-year, with international users representing approximately 85% of monthly active users and accounting for 54% of revenue in Q4 [25][26] - The company added 951 net customers spending more than $10,000 in ARR and 143 net customers spending more than $100,000 in ARR, with the latter growing by 46% year-over-year [23] Company Strategy and Development Direction - Figma is focused on defining new AI-native workflows and supporting customers adapting to new ways of working, while maintaining a disciplined approach to scaling the business [30][31] - The company aims to enhance integration between Figma Make and Figma Design, emphasizing the importance of round-tripping between code and design [59] Management's Comments on Operating Environment and Future Outlook - Management expressed confidence in the long-term cash-generating profile of the business, despite a decline in adjusted free cash flow in Q4 due to investments in infrastructure and AI [28][29] - For Q1 2026, Figma expects revenue in the range of $315 million to $317 million, implying 38% growth at the midpoint, and for the full year, revenue is anticipated to be between $1.366 billion and $1.374 billion, implying 30% growth at the midpoint [31] Other Important Information - The company is seeing a shift in user types, with product managers and other non-designers increasingly engaging with Figma Make, indicating potential for seat expansion [45][62] - Figma's AI image editing capabilities were significantly enhanced, with over 10 million uses in just a few weeks after updates [18] Q&A Session Summary Question: Insights on the impact of agentic layer offerings on UI/UX - Management believes that while agents will take on more work, humans will still need to understand and trust the processes, necessitating visual interfaces [36][38] Question: Guidance on 2026 revenue and credit consumption monetization - Management expects to refine guidance based on observed seat adoption behavior and usage trends, with 75% of paid customers consuming AI credits weekly [40][41] Question: Competition in the prototyping space and budget implications - Management noted that over 80% of Figma Make users also use Figma Design, indicating a strong integration opportunity and potential for budget consolidation [58][59] Question: Future partnerships with AI companies - Management is focused on ensuring that as AI models improve, Figma also enhances its offerings, while exploring deeper partnerships with AI providers [68][69]
